The Mayor and Commonalty and Citizens of the City of London

The Mayor and Commonalty and Citizens of the City of London is a UK public-sector contracting authority. This profile aggregates its public-record procurement — top suppliers, categories, recent awards, open tenders and expiring contracts.

According to ENKII, The Mayor and Commonalty and Citizens of the City of London has awarded 556 contracts worth £540.8M to 451 suppliers between 2023-06-17 and 2026-06-17, at an average contract value of £1.8M, with the top five suppliers holding 69% of contract value.
